How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Terra Nova?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Terra Nova Studio Apartments | $2,172 | $1,700 | $3,060 |
| Terra Nova 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,492 | $1,895 | $4,654 |
| Terra Nova 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,837 | $2,295 | $4,025 |
| Terra Nova 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,667 | $3,000 | $7,166 |
